Overall Meaning

Hooverphonic's "Music Box" is a song that is open to interpretation, and the lyrics are cryptic enough to give rise to different meanings. At its heart, however, the song appears to deal with the theme of sin, crime, and alchemy, using the metaphor of a "music box" that alludes to the inherent beauty and complexity of life. The first verse highlights the sinister nature of sin, with the need to "start to pray" to avoid succumbing to the sensual and tempting allure of crime. The second verse talks about the impact of this sin on oneself, with the metaphor of a "poisoned arrow softly piercing" one's heart with poetry, leading to the eventual swallowing up by the sea. The refrain, "a tempting sign is showing us a glimpse of alchemy, the curtain drops whenever we do try to react as if we're one," suggests that the consequences of our actions are inevitable, and that trying to deny or escape them inevitably leads to failure.


Overall, "Music Box" is an evocative song that blends beautiful and haunting melodies with a deep and enigmatic set of lyrics. The use of metaphors and symbols adds depth and nuance to the song's themes, making it an interpretive feast for those who appreciate poetic music.
